Still pré-printing badges?
1. IT'S UP TO DATE Live badging synchronizes visitor data in real time
2. IT'S FLEXIBLE Live printing in different colors or designs per category
3. IT'S SUSTAINABLE No more wasted badges for no-shows
4. IT'S FASTER It takes only seven seconds from ticket scan to printed butterfly badge.
5. IT'S CHEAPER No more valuable time wasted before the event.
Here’s 10 reasons not to !
6. IT'S PROFESSIONAL Walk-ins and name changes receive the same quality badge as other visitors
7. IT'S CONNECTED Live badging keeps track of all visitor arrivals. It also gives you a live count of the number of visitors checked in, as well as real-time visitor listings.
8. IT'S SECURE Profile pictures can be printed straight from the registration database for secured access.
9. IT'S AN OPPORTUNITY Large dual-sided butterfly badges provide enough space to include sponsor branding.
10. IT'S LESS STRESSFUL You deserve a good night’s sleep – use your energy for more important things.

Is self service the new standard?
1. EFFICIENT STAFFING Kiosks allow you to better balance your staff in peak moments.
2. SEEMINGLY LESS QUEUING Delegates have the impression it takes less long, because they are in charge.
3. LESS CHANCE FOR HUMAN ERROR Technology, checks balance due and ticket validation.
4. SPACE SAVING It takes 40 x 40 cm floorspace
5. FLEXIBLE DEPLOYMENT You can move them around, from airport, to hotel, to check-inn to workshops.
6. PEOPLE ARE USED TO IT Self service is everywhere, in banking, retail, travel.. and now in events.
7. DON’T GO THE FULL MONTY Keep in mind that a warm human welcome is important, don’t replace all people by machines, find a good mix of hospitality and technology.

Live badgingBeware of the 3 pitfalls !
1. STORE DATA LOCALLY Never organize live badging through a web-interface
2. STAY SYNCHRONIZED Make sure all data is stored on each of the local devices
3. BACKUP POWER Power will fail ! - Provide UPS backup system

Tracing technology5 things to remember?
1. THERE IS SUCH THING AS 1 PERFECT SOLUTION Using the right combined technologies for the objectives is the best solution.
2. BEWARE OF PRIVACY Make sure you have the legal aspects covered, inform your delegates, ask permission or scan anonimously.
3.CENTRALIZE & CONNECT DATA Connect all tracing technologies to the same platform to get 1 central reporting.
4. PUT YOUR OBJECTIVES FIRST Technology is there to serve your objectives, make sure you have your priorities right!
5. USELESS DATA IS WAISTED MONEY Make sure you have a follow-up plan to actually USE the data in your organization. Way to often companies are sitting on valuable information and have no resources or plan for it.

Tracing technologyThe Big 5 in a nutshell
1. BARCODE SCANNING effective, cheap and easy, but needs more staffing.
2. RFID Good for rough data and crowdsourcing, difficult in setup.
3.NFC Touch to go, quick, reliable and easy setup.
4. i BEACONS Good luck to have your delegates switch on their bluetooth and download the app.
5. m BEACONS Best way to scan, but still expensive.
